Maximal aerobic capacity in African-American and Caucasian prepubertal children

Insights

African-American children exhibit approximately 15% lower maximal oxygen consumption (VO2max) compared to Caucasian children. This difference in VO2max persists regardless of body composition or energy expenditure factors.

Area of Science:

  • Pediatric Exercise Physiology
  • Ethnic Differences in Physiology
  • Cardiorespiratory Fitness

Background:

  • Understanding ethnic variations in physiological responses during childhood is crucial for tailored health and fitness recommendations.
  • Prepubertal children's cardiorespiratory fitness, particularly maximal oxygen consumption (VO2max), may differ across ethnic groups.
  • Previous research has not fully elucidated ethnic differences in VO2max adjusted for body composition and energy expenditure in young children.

Purpose of the Study:

  • To investigate ethnic disparities in resting, submaximal, and maximal oxygen consumption (VO2max) between African-American and Caucasian prepubertal children.
  • To determine if differences in VO2max are influenced by body composition (fat mass, lean tissue mass) and energy expenditure (TEE, AEE).

Main Methods:

  • Indirect calorimetry for resting VO2 measurement.
  • Progressive treadmill tests to determine submaximal and maximal VO2 (VO2max).
  • Dual-energy X-ray absorptiometry for body composition analysis (FM, LTM, leg LTM).
  • Doubly labeled water technique to assess total energy expenditure (TEE) and activity energy expenditure (AEE).

Main Results:

  • A significant ethnic effect was observed for VO2max (P < 0.01), with African-American children showing approximately 15% lower absolute VO2max than Caucasian children.
  • These ethnic differences in VO2max remained significant after adjusting for soft lean tissue mass, leg soft lean tissue mass, and fat mass.
  • The lower VO2max in African-American children persisted even after adjustments for total energy expenditure and activity energy expenditure.

Conclusions:

  • African-American and Caucasian children demonstrate similar resting and submaximal oxygen consumption rates.
  • Maximal oxygen consumption (VO2max) is significantly lower in African-American children compared to Caucasian children.
  • This ethnic disparity in VO2max is independent of variations in body composition and energy expenditure.
